Poly(Methyl Methacrylate) Sterically Stabilized by Silicone [PDF]

open access: yes, 1991
Nonaqueous poly(methyl methacrylate) latices were prepared by nonaqueous dispersion polymerization of poly(methyl methacrylate) in heptane in the presence of either trimethylsilyl terminated or vinyl terminated polydimethylsiloxane stabilizer.

Existence of Two Phases in Poly(methyl methacrylate) [PDF]

open access: yesPolymer Journal, 1979
The ESR spectral change in spin-labeled poly(methyl methacrylate) (PMMA) was investigated in the solid phase at various temperatures. There appeared a shoulder on the spectrum from 138°C to 188°C and it is concluded that this shoulder originates from the existence of the two kinds of motion in this temperature region.
